About
Niche - a genetics survival game is a turn-based strategy game combined with simulation and roguelike elements. Shape your own species of animals based on real genetics. Keep your species alive against all odds, such as predators, climate change and spreading sickness.

Niche: A Genetics Survival Game — Session FAQ
- How long does a session of Niche: A Genetics Survival Game take?
- The minimum meaningful session for Niche: A Genetics Survival Game is approximately 30 minutes. This is the shortest play window where you can make real progress or have a satisfying experience, based on community data.
- Can you pause Niche: A Genetics Survival Game?
- Niche: A Genetics Survival Game uses save points or manual saves. You'll need to reach a checkpoint before exiting to avoid losing progress — factor this into your session planning.
- Does Niche: A Genetics Survival Game pressure you to keep playing?
- Niche: A Genetics Survival Game has low FOMO. There may be some narrative momentum, but the game doesn't pressure you to keep playing. Natural stopping points are common.
- What is Niche: A Genetics Survival Game's Session Respect Score?
- Niche: A Genetics Survival Game has a Session Respect Score of 6.2/10. This score combines minimum session length, pausability, FOMO level, and pickup friendliness into a single metric for how well the game fits busy schedules.
